OPPORTUNITY SNAPSHOT:
Our Systems Analyst role works with the business and the IT departments, to identify and implement IT solutions that enable and support the business. You will provide business user support by helping troubleshoot business application or business process issues and provide assistance in setting up application configurations, controls, and user provisioning.
A DAY IN THE LIFE:
-
Develop and communicate application upgrades, maintenance windows, test scripts and user acceptance testing.
-
Manage optimization requests and works with leaders to prioritize in support of the business drivers.
-
Provide assistance to the business users in defining and documenting requirements for system improvements.
-
Help in developing positive customer relationships which makes it possible to influence positive change and contribute to collaboration in defining and implementing IT solutions.
-
Work with other analysts to provide operational consulting to business groups in the use of their systems to support effective business processes.
